Embodiment 1

[0043] Patient Li XX, the examination of the cervix found that the surface of the cervix was smooth or erosive, hard, and easy to bleed when touched.

[0044] Step (1). Pretreatment of exfoliated cells:

[0045] The gynecologist used a special cervical brush for gynecology to obtain exfoliated cells from the patient's cervix, put them into 10-50wt% methanol solution to fix the exfoliated cells, and obtained the pretreated sample solution, which was stored at 0°C;

[0046] Step (2). Centrifugal aggregation of exfoliated cells:

[0047] First add 20μl 1wt﹪saponin to the test tube, then add 5ml of the sample solution obtained in step (1), centrifuge at 2000 rpm for 10 minutes, and discard the supernatant;

[0048] The saponin is used to destroy red blood cells in the sample solution;

[0049] Step (3). The total amount of exfoliated cells is counted:

Abstract

The invention discloses a squamous cell carcinoma SCC-TCT combined detection method. The squamous cell carcinoma SCC-TCT combined detection method comprises the following steps: sampling exfoliated cells at a cervical part, and preprocessing to obtain a sample solution; centrifugating saponin and the sample solution, taking precipitate, adding a phosphate buffer solution, uniformly mixing, and counting the total cell number; centrifugating a counted cell suspension, adding the phosphate buffer solution for freezing and thawing at least once to obtain a sample solution of which an SCC antigen is dissociated and released; performing intracellular SCC antigen enzyme-labeled determination analysis; carrying out judging and screening according to a determination result, screening out a sample higher than a critical value, and preparing the sample solution corresponding to the sample into a uniform slide on a liquid-based cytometer, fixing, performing papanicolaou staining, performing morphological cell analysis by using a microscope, and judging the morphology of a tumor cell. According to the squamous cell carcinoma SCC-TCT combined detection method, by an SCC-TCT combined detection technology, 80-90% of normal samples are screened out, so that the working efficiency of a pathological doctor can be improved.

Description

technical field [0001] The invention belongs to the field of biotechnology, and relates to a method for joint detection of human squamous epithelial cancer antigen cells (SCC) and liquid-based cells (TCT), in particular to a human exfoliated cell, that is, exfoliated squamous epithelial cells Cancer antigen (SCC) detection is a method to screen out positive or suspected samples and then conduct liquid-based cell (TCT) pathological cell morphology analysis. Background technique [0002] Cervical cancer is one of the most common malignant tumors of the female reproductive tract, and its incidence rate is the second among female malignant tumors, accounting for about 11% of all tumors. In some developing countries, the incidence of cervical cancer even exceeds the incidence of breast cancer, becoming the first female malignant tumor.
